Defining Emotional Trauma and Stroke

Emotional trauma is a psychological response to deeply distressing events that overwhelm an individual’s ability to cope. It can stem from a single incident, such as a car accident or witnessing violence, or from ongoing stressors like neglect or abuse. The mental impact can be as significant as physical injuries.

A stroke is a serious medical event where blood flow to a part of the brain is interrupted, leading to brain tissue death. There are two primary types: ischemic strokes, caused by a blood clot blocking a brain vessel, and hemorrhagic strokes, caused by a ruptured blood vessel bleeding into the surrounding tissue. Ischemic strokes account for about 87% of all strokes, while hemorrhagic strokes make up approximately 10-15%.

The Body’s Response to Intense Emotional Stress

When faced with intense emotional stress or trauma, the body activates its “fight or flight” response. This physiological reaction, triggered by the sympathetic nervous system, prepares the body to confront or escape a perceived threat. The hypothalamus, a tiny region at the brain’s base, initiates this alarm system.

This activation leads to the rapid release of stress hormones—primarily adrenaline, noradrenaline, and cortisol—from the adrenal glands. These hormones cause immediate physiological changes, including increased heart rate, elevated blood pressure, and faster breathing rate. Blood flow is also redirected towards muscles and the brain, away from non-essential functions like digestion, and the body’s blood clotting ability increases to prepare for potential injury.

Mechanisms Linking Trauma to Stroke Risk

The physiological responses to emotional stress contribute to stroke risk through several mechanisms. Sustained high blood pressure, or hypertension, is a significant factor. While acute stress causes temporary blood pressure spikes, chronic emotional stress can lead to persistently elevated levels. This ongoing high pressure strains the heart and blood vessels, damaging arteries, including those in the brain. Such damage makes them susceptible to blockages causing ischemic stroke, or weakening them to rupture, leading to hemorrhagic stroke.

Emotional stress also promotes systemic inflammation. Stress hormones can trigger inflammatory cytokines, chemicals contributing to atherosclerosis, where plaque builds up and hardens arteries. This hardening and narrowing increases blood clot formation and restricts blood flow to the brain, raising ischemic stroke risk.

Furthermore, stress can alter the blood’s clotting ability, making it thicker and more prone to forming clots. Psychological stress elevates levels of coagulation factors and increases platelet activity, making them more likely to clump together. This pro-thrombotic state directly increases ischemic stroke risk.

Severe emotional stress can trigger heart rhythm abnormalities, such as atrial fibrillation (AFib). AFib is an irregular, often rapid heartbeat that can lead to blood pooling in the heart’s upper chambers, increasing clot formation. If these clots travel to the brain, they can cause an embolic stroke.

Long-Term Trauma and Stroke Risk

The impact of emotional trauma on stroke risk extends beyond immediate reactions, especially with chronic exposure. Conditions like Post-Traumatic Stress Disorder (PTSD) exemplify how sustained psychological distress can accumulate and significantly increase stroke risk over time. PTSD is associated with prolonged intense psychological stress, leading to persistent physiological changes.

Individuals with PTSD often exhibit chronic inflammation, high blood pressure, and persistent changes in blood clotting factors. These sustained alterations can accelerate atherosclerosis and other cardiovascular issues, increasing the risk of both ischemic and hemorrhagic strokes, sometimes years after the initial traumatic event. Studies show younger adults with PTSD may face heightened stroke risk by middle age, sometimes surpassing risks from other known factors like diabetes or obesity.

When to Seek Medical Advice

Recognizing stroke signs and acting quickly is important, regardless of one’s emotional state or trauma history. The acronym FAST helps identify common stroke symptoms: Face drooping, Arm weakness, Speech difficulty, and Time to call emergency services. If any of these signs appear suddenly, immediate medical attention is necessary by calling 911 or local emergency services.

Other stroke symptoms can include sudden numbness or weakness on one side of the body, blurred vision or loss of sight, confusion, difficulty walking, or a sudden, severe headache. Even if symptoms are mild or disappear, prompt medical evaluation is important, as timely treatment can significantly reduce brain damage and improve recovery outcomes. Individuals who have experienced emotional trauma, or are experiencing chronic stress-related symptoms, should consult a healthcare professional for assessment and support.
